Seed funding for mobility planning and infrastructure in the South Baltic region

We (lead partner), together with partners in Viimsi (Estonia) and Klaipeda (Lithuania), have got seed funding from the Swedish Institute for a 1-year  project "Seeds for sustainable mobility planning and infrastructure" (SESUMOPLIN) that will start in September 2021. Presentation at CSTFM about a process and catalogue of solutions for sustainable PT

SustainTrans member Sven Borén presented at the online International conference on smart transportation and future mobility (CSTFM) the 19th of October 2020 about a process and a catalogue of solutions for cross-border and regional public transport.
